Lohrajpur - Chunar, Mirzapur

Lohrajpur is a village situated in the Chunar tehsil of Mirzapur district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 30 km from the tehsil headquarters in Chunar and around 64 km from the district headquarters in Mirzapur. Bhokraudh serves as the Gram Panchayat for Lohrajpur village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Lohrajpur is 212783. The village covers a total geographical area of 43.07 hectares and falls under the 231302 pincode.

Lohrajpur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Marihan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Mirzapur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Lohrajpur

As per Census 2011, Lohrajpur village has a total population of 668 people, consisting of 339 males and 329 females. The village has 117 households and a sex ratio of 970 females per 1,000 males. There are 117 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 295 literate and 373 illiterate residents. Additionally, 134 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Lohrajpur

Public transport facilities are available within >10 km of the Lohrajpur. The nearest railway station is Ahraura Road, while the nearest airport is Lal Bahadur Shastri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 40.6 km.
